Has anyone been to the Atlantis Resort during your port stop? If so did you book with the boat or did you go through the hotel. I would rather just buy tickets myself with the hotel but cant seem to find any info on their site about such things. Thanks in advance for any help.

It depends on what you want to do at the resort. You can purchase tickets directly from the hotel for $25 to view the aquarium and take "The Dig" tour. The "Atlantis Beach Breaks" that are offered by the cruise lines allow you to use the beach (a designated area is assigned to cruisers), and usually provide a lunch, BUT you can only walk around the pool area - you can not use the pools, water slides, lazy river, etc. A wrist band is required that is only issued to guests of Atlantis or Comfort Suites. If you wish to use all the facilities, my suggestion would be to book a room at the Comfort Suites for the day ahead of time. They have full resort privileges and - depending on how many people are traveling together, can actualy be much cheaper than the cruise excursion.
